An independent, upscale American Grill located in the heart of downtown featuring an ambience exuding class and sophistication in a comfortable setting. While the lively bar is the focal point, unique dining rooms incorporate dark woods, lush fabrics and a deep color palette. This sister restaurant to the famous St. Elmo Steak House shares a few classic dishes, while offering more menu variety. Serving lunch and dinner daily.

Great experience!
I contacted the manager a week in advance to secure a table for 10. She offered a semi-private table for us that ended up as an absolutely perfect choice. The appetizers were incredible and the wine list was very extensive. My wife ordered her steak medium and it came well done. The waitress immediately took it back and returned a few minutes later with a steak that my wife described as "perfect." The waitress was VERY accommodating to any request that we made. For example, the smallest filet on the menu is a 10 oz. portion - too large for some appetites. The waitress offered a 7 oz. portion as another option. We will definitely go back!

Yum
This is not a cheap lunch. However, if you're looking for more than burgers or deli fare, this is a great place to indulge your taste buds. I had a steak sandwich and my friend had the prawns. Both were outstanding and proved worth every dollar. The outdoor dining is great as you're in the heart of downtown. Inside, the decor is cool and classy yet much more contemporary than St. Elmo's (its sister restaurant).

Best steak in town
If you are a fan of steak, you can't go wrong. I would recommend the "Izzy Style New York Strip." It was terrific! My wife had the chopped steak with blue cheese. Again very good entree which was actually priced well. And of course the shrimp cocktail is a must. Overall I would say that the owners did the perfect thing with this restaurant; they took the things everyone likes about St. Elmo's and fixed the atmosphere and selection at which people wish St. Elmo's was better. All in all a great dining experience.
